Table I.

Analysis of risk factors, concomitant procedures, and incidence of shoulder stiffness distributed by follow-up visit

Risk factor Time point 4 (12 weeks)
Time point 5 (16-24 weeks)
Time point 6 (52 weeks)
Stiff Not stiff P value Stiff Not stiff P value Stiff Not stiff P value
Age, mean (SD), yr 58.2 (8.5) 57.4 (7.3) .74 51.8 (7.3) 57.6 (7.3) .12 50.5 (12.0) 57.6 (7.3) .18
Sex, n (%)
 Female 5 (55.6) 38 (32.5) .27 3 (75.0) 40 (32.8) .11 2 (100.0) 41 (33.1) .11
 Male 4 (44.44) 79 (67.5) 1 (25.0) 82 (67.2) 0 (0.0) 83 (66.9)
Hyperlipidemia, n (%)
 Yes 1 (11.1) 26 (22.2) .68 1 (25.0) 26 (21.3) >.99 1 (50.0) 26 (21.0) .38
 No 8 (77.8) 91 (77.8) 3 (75.0) 96 (78.7) 1 (50.0) 98 (79.0)
Hypertension, n (%)
 Yes 3 (33.3) 35 (29.9) >.99 2 (50.0) 36 (29.5) .58 1 (50.0) 37 (29.8) .51
 No 6 (66.7) 82 (70.1) 2 (50.0) 86 (70.5) 1 (50.0) 87 (70.2)
Workers’ compensation insurance, n (%)
 Yes 3 (33.3) 29 (24.8) .69 1 (25.0) 31 (25.4) >.99 0 (0.0) 32 (25.8) >.99
 No 6 (66.7) 88 (75.2) 3 (75.0) 91 (74.6) 2 (100.0) 92 (74.2)
Subacromial decompression, n (%)
 Yes 6 (66.7) 82 (70.1) >.99 2 (50.0) 86 (29.5) .58 1 (50.0) 87 (70.2) .51
 No 3 (33.3) 35 (29.9) 2 (50.0) 36 (70.5) 1 (50.0) 37 (29.8)
Débridement, n (%)
 Yes 2 (22.2) 25 (21.4) >.99 1 (25.0) 26 (21.3) >.99 0 (0.0) 27 (21.8) >.99
 No 7 (77.8) 92 (78.6) 3 (75.0) 96 (78.7) 2 (100.0) 97 (78.2)
Biceps tenotomy or tenodesis, n (%)
 Yes 5 (55.6) 29 (24.8) .06 2 (50.0) 32 (26.2) .29 1 (50.0) 33 (26.6) .47
 No 4 (44.4) 88 (75.2) 2 (50.0) 90 (73.8) 1 (50.0) 91 (73.4)
Total, n (%) 9 (7.1) 117 (92.9) 4 (3.2) 122 (96.8) 2 (1.6) 124 (98.4)

SD, standard deviation.

Stiffness was defined as total range of motion between passive forward flexion and abducted external rotation ≤ 220°.
